How to retrieve the 3D rotation angle on each axis?
I have a Model3DGroup which is rotated around any of the x, y, z axis using an AxisAngleRotation3D applied on the Transform property of the object.
The problem is that I am not in control of the various rotations applied on the mesh. I need to display the angle of the mesh on each of the x, y, z axis at each render loop.
How can I do that? I tried retrieving the AxisAngleRotation3D object on the object, but it only g开发者_StackOverflowives me the rotation that was last applied. Which is not correct.
If for example there was an applied rotation of Axis: Vector3D(1, 1, 0) Angle: 45
The actual rotation around Z axis would not be 0. How can I get the actual angle on each axis?
double rotationX = Vector3D.AngleBetween(new Vector3D(1, 0, 0), yourMatrix3D.Transform(new Vector3D(1, 0, 0)));
double rotationY = Vector3D.AngleBetween(new Vector3D(0, 1, 0), yourMatrix3D.Transform(new Vector3D(0, 1, 0)));
double rotationZ = Vector3D.AngleBetween(new Vector3D(0, 0, 1), yourMatrix3D.Transform(new Vector3D(0, 0, 1)));
The Model3DGroup.Transform.Value property is a Matrix3D representing the complete transform. http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/system.windows.media.media3d.matrix3d.aspx
The elements of the matrix represent the complete transform. The conversion from matrix form to rotation angles (Euler angles) is quite straightforward. See for example http://www.euclideanspace.com/maths/geometry/rotations/conversions/matrixToEuler/index.htm
